Reading the figures correctly

A model. Not a general earnings range.

€15,000 to €50,000 is not a general level of earnings.

Whether an amount applies per person, per course or across multiple course runs makes a big difference. In the AI example, 12 people × 300 units × €11.82 produce course revenue of €42,552 over the full duration. Actual costs must be deducted.

The AI example in detail

Individual coaching needs individual capacity.

Five people receiving 200 units each require 1,000 delivered teaching units in individual coaching. In group teaching, twelve people can be taught together. The calculator distinguishes these cost and capacity models.
